+Double_t AliTimestamp::GetDifference(AliTimestamp& t,TString u,Int_t mode)
+{
+// Provide the time difference w.r.t the AliTimestamp specified on the input
+// argument in the units as specified by the TString argument.
+// A positive return value means that the AliTimestamp specified on the input
+// argument occurred later, whereas a negative return value indicates an
+// earlier occurence.
+//
+// The units may be specified as :
+// u = "d" ==> Time difference returned as (fractional) day count
+// "s" ==> Time difference returned as (fractional) second count
+// "ns" ==> Time difference returned as (fractional) nanosecond count
+// "ps" ==> Time difference returned as picosecond count
+//
+// It may be clear that for a time difference of several days, the picosecond
+// and even the nanosecond accuracy may be lost.
+// To cope with this, the "mode" argument has been introduced to allow
+// timestamp comparison on only the specified units.
+//
+// The following operation modes are supported :
+// mode = 1 : Full time difference is returned in specified units
+// 2 : Time difference is returned in specified units by
+// neglecting the elapsed time for the larger units than the
+// ones specified.
+// 3 : Time difference is returned in specified units by only
+// comparing the timestamps on the level of the specified units.
+//
+// Example :
+// ---------
+// AliTimestamp t1; // Corresponding to days=3, secs=501, ns=31, ps=7
+// AliTimestamp t2; // Corresponding to days=5, secs=535, ns=12, ps=15
+//
+// The statement : Double_t val=t1.GetDifference(t2,....)
+// would return the following values :
+// val=(2*24*3600)+34-(19*1e-9)+(8*1e-12) for u="s" and mode=1
+// val=34-(19*1e-9)+(8*1e-12) for u="s" and mode=2
+// val=34 for u="s" and mode=3
+// val=-19 for u="ns" and mode=3
+//
+// The default is mode=1.
+
+ return GetDifference(&t,u,mode);
+}
